**Duties and Responsibilities**
- **Project Oversight**: Conduct regular sites visits to follow planned scheduled tasks ensuring adherence to schedules and budgets. Use our construction management software to manage aspects of each project.
- **Quality Control**: Inspect work performed to ensure it meets the project specifications and building codes. Address and report issues promptly to maintain high-quality standards.
- **Safety Compliance**: Implement and enforce safety protocols to ensure a safe working environment.
- **Communication & Reporting**: Serve as the primary point of contact between the renovation sites and management. Provide regular updates on project progress, challenges, and solutions.
- **Problem Solving**: Identify and resolve any minor issues or conflicts that arise during the renovation process.
- **Material Management: **Ensure materials are handled efficiently and report issues accordingly.
- **People Management**: Grow employee skillsets and performance through coaching and positive discipline.
- **Hands-On Work: **Proficient in specific construction and interior finishings like finish carpentry, framing, drywall and taping, rough and finish plumbing, rough and finish electrical, painting, and tiling.

**Physical Demands**
- Handling construction materials manually.
- Ability and dexterity to lift and support up to 75lbs independently.
- Walking, standing, climbing, crouching, bending, twisting the body.
- Making repetitive motion.
- Climbing up tall ladders, working at elevated levels

**Work Environment**
- Work takes place onsite of homes under construction; all required PPE must be worn while onsite (hard hat, steel toe boots, mask and ventilator, hearing protection) as required.
- Work takes place in variable weather conditions, year-round; be prepared for warm and cold days, rain and snow.
- Dust filled environment at multiple stages of the construction process.
- Sound, noise, hazardous conditions, high places, vibration, hazardous equipment, machinery and tools.
